1. Smart Home Integration
Technology is becoming an essential part of modern interiors.
Popular smart features include:
Voice-controlled lighting
Automated curtains
Smart security systems
Smart climate control
Energy management systems
Connected appliances
Designers now plan interiors that seamlessly integrate technology into everyday living.
2. Sustainable Interior Design
Eco-friendly interiors continue to gain popularity.
Trending sustainable features include:
Recycled materials
Bamboo furniture
Low-VOC paints
LED lighting
Natural fabrics
Energy-efficient layouts
Sustainability is becoming a standard expectation rather than an optional feature.
3. Warm Earthy Color Palettes
Cool grey interiors are giving way to warmer, nature-inspired shades.
Popular colors include:
Terracotta
Olive green
Sand beige
Clay tones
Warm browns
Soft cream
These colors create calm, welcoming, and timeless interiors.
4. Biophilic Design
Nature-inspired interiors remain one of the strongest trends.
Common elements include:
Indoor plants
Natural stone
Wooden finishes
Large windows
Natural lighting
Organic textures
Biophilic design improves well-being while enhancing visual appeal.
5. Multi-Functional Spaces
Homes are becoming more flexible.
Popular ideas include:
Home offices
Foldable furniture
Modular storage
Convertible rooms
Multipurpose living spaces
Flexible layouts are especially important in urban apartments.
6. AI-Powered Interior Design
Artificial intelligence is transforming the design process.
AI helps with:
Space planning
Furniture visualization
Material selection
Color suggestions
Budget planning
3D rendering
Rather than replacing designers, AI is becoming a tool that improves efficiency and creativity.
7. Textured and Layered Interiors
Designers are adding depth through materials instead of excessive decoration.
Popular textures include:
Wood
Stone
Linen
Bouclé fabrics
Textured walls
Handmade décor
Layering textures creates warm and inviting interiors.
8. Personalized Interiors
Instead of copying trends, homeowners want spaces that reflect their personalities.
Personal touches include:
Custom furniture
Family artwork
Handmade décor
Vintage pieces
Statement lighting
Personalization is becoming more important than perfectly matching interiors.
9. Curved Furniture and Organic Shapes
Soft curves continue to replace sharp edges.
Trending designs include:
Curved sofas
Rounded tables
Arched doorways
Circular mirrors
Sculptural furniture
Organic shapes make interiors feel more comfortable and elegant.
10. Quiet Luxury
Luxury in 2026 focuses on quality rather than excess.
Key characteristics include:
Premium materials
Elegant craftsmanship
Minimal decoration
Neutral color palettes
Timeless furniture
The emphasis is on refined, long-lasting design rather than flashy décor.
